Greenbug Dispersal and Distribution of Barley Yellow Dwarf Virus in Wisconsin

Abstract
Yellow pan traps were used in Kansas, Missouri and Wisconsin to study the northward dispersal of the greenbug, Toxoptera graminum (Rond.). Wind-borne greenbugs that arrived in Wisconsin probably introduced the barley yellow dwarf virus disease of oats. Chemical control measures used against the greenbug when populations became abundant were ineffective because of virus already spread in the crop.
